Job Description

IT Asset Refurbishment Technician Overview We are looking for a person who is interested in learning the ins and outs of many computer based, technically related items. If you enjoy problem solving and working with a small team this job is for you. You will get hands-on experience with a number of manufacturers products — Cisco, Dell, Pax, Verifone and many more. You will be working with Servers, Desktops, Laptops, Credit Card terminals and many more. This position is ideal for someone who enjoys learning something new almost every day. If you're willing to put the work in, this position comes with a high chance of personal and professional growth — and if you would enjoy working in a fast paced and casual environment, we'd love to hear from you. Job Tasks and Responsibilities Inspection and assessment of products. Making determinations and preparing good assets for resale. You will be organizing, stacking, and possibly wrapping assets for resale. Testing and grading payment devices, laptops, desktops, servers, and networking equipment, along with many other items. Ensuring quality and security standards are met to maintain our current certifications. Requirements High school diploma is required; higher education is preferred. Basic computer literacy — comfortable using Excel and writing professional emails. Knowledge of PC components is required; experience building a PC is a plus. Ability to multi-task. Able to lift 50 lbs. A strong attention to detail is required. Ability to act professionally and communicate effectively. A strong drive to work with and learn about computers.
